In August of 2004, 12-year-old Garrett Bardsley vanished during a Boy Scout camping trip in the Uinta Mountains of Utah. Just moments after stepping away to change out of wet clothes, Garrett was gone — without a sound, without a trace. Despite a massive search effort and national attention, no sign of Garrett has ever been definitively found.
